首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Windows上的C++ - 控制台窗口只是闪烁并消失.这是怎么回事?

在Windows上,控制台窗口只是闪烁并消失的问题可能有多种原因。以下是可能的原因和解决方法:

  1. 程序执行完毕:如果你运行的C++程序只是一个简单的命令行程序,并且没有任何等待用户输入或者其他交互操作,那么程序执行完毕后,控制台窗口会立即关闭。你可以在程序的最后添加一个等待用户输入的语句,例如使用system("pause"),这样控制台窗口就会等待用户按下任意键后才关闭。
  2. 编译错误:如果你的C++程序存在编译错误,可能会导致程序无法正常执行。在控制台窗口闪烁并消失之前,可能会有一闪而过的错误提示窗口。你可以检查你的代码,确保没有语法错误或者其他编译错误。
  3. 程序崩溃:如果你的C++程序在执行过程中发生了崩溃,控制台窗口可能会立即关闭。这种情况下,你可以尝试使用调试工具来定位并修复程序中的错误。
  4. 程序被其他进程关闭:某些安全软件或者系统设置可能会在程序执行时自动关闭控制台窗口。你可以尝试关闭一些可能会干扰程序执行的软件或者调整系统设置。

总结起来,控制台窗口只是闪烁并消失的问题可能是由于程序执行完毕、编译错误、程序崩溃或者被其他进程关闭等原因引起的。你可以根据具体情况进行排查和解决。如果问题仍然存在,建议你提供更多的细节和代码,以便更好地帮助你解决问题。

注意:以上回答中没有提及云计算相关内容,因为该问题与云计算领域无关。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券